SolarBullet Campaign to bring high-speed solar trains to Arizona

“Cruising at the expense of environment” will not be an acceptable reason to deny bullet trains an honorable mention in the future. Well, to back them up, the zero-emission solar-powered bullet trains called Solar Bullet will seek to prove their point in traveling between Tucson and Phoenix in just 30 minutes at 220 miles per hour; and that too, sans a speck of emissions. All this is being done under the SolarBullet Campaign.

A huge solar array over the tracks will generate the required renewable energy for the zero-carbon mass transit. For this purpose, a team of university experts, engineers and transit specialists will join forces to strengthen the project. Moreover, it will go on to “increase awareness and support among Arizonians” for solar technology.
